David Tvildiani Medical University MBBS Fees Structure (2026-27)

Fee Includes1st Year2nd Year3rd Year4th Year5th Year6th YearTotal
Tuition Fee6,000 $6,000 $6,000 $6,000 $6,000 $6,000 $36,000 $
Hostel Fee1,800 $1,800 $1,800 $1,800 $1,800 $1,800 $10,800 $
Mess Fee1,200 $1,200 $1,200 $1,200 $1,200 $1,200 $7,200 $
Administrative Charges2,000 $2,000 $
Total Fee11,000 $9,000 $9,000 $9,000 $9,000 $9,000 $56,000 $

FMGE Performance of David Tvildiani Medical University

YearPassing Rate
202175.86%
202266.06%
202340.91%
202448.50%

MBBS at David Tvildiani Medical University Eligibility Criteria for Indian Students in 2026-27

Indian students seeking to study MBBS in Georgia at David Tvildiani Medical University must fulfil the eligibility requirements laid down by the NMC:

Age RequirementCandidates must obtain the age of 17 years old at the time of admission or as on December 31st of the admission year.
Academic RequirementsFor the General Category, candidates must have qualified 10+2 from a recognised board with a minimum aggregate of 50% in PCB subjects.
For the Reserved Category (ST/SC/OBC), the minimum aggregate score should be 40% in the PCB subjects.
NEET UG RequirementCandidates must have qualified NEET UG Exam and have a valid NEET UG Scorecard.

Documents Required for MBBS in Georgia for Indian Students

Indian students who want to study MBBS at David Tvildiani Medical University   must submit the following required documents for MBBS admission in 2026-27

  • Scanned copies of 10+2 marksheets and certificate
  • NEET Scorecard
  • Admission letter from the university
  • Birth Certificate
  • Medical Certificate + HIV Test Report
  • Coloured passport-size photographs
  • Valid passport with 1 year validity
  • Apostille documents 
  • Invitation Letter from the University
  • Student visa
